#b4ce56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4ce56 is composed of 70.6% red, 80.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 57.3%. #b4ce56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#699d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b4ce56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4ce56 has RGB values of R:180, G:206,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 11849302.

Shades and Tints of #b4ce56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4ce56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939391 is the less saturated color, while #ccf82c is the most saturated one.
